Under Liebo , a defendant seeking a new trial based upon newly discovered evidence must demonstrate that all of the following criteria have been met: (1) the evidence was in fact newly discovered since the trial; (2) the defendant has alleged facts from which the court may infer diligence on the defendant’s part; (3) the evidence relied upon is not merely cumulative or impeaching; (4) the evidence is material to the issues involved; and (5) the evidence is of such a nature that, on a new trial, it would probably produce an acquittal. 923 F.2d at 1313 ; see also United States v.
